Course Information
Blacknest Golf Club, Hampshire is an 18 hole, par 69 (5974 yard), public, parkland golf course.
18 holes | Par 69 | 5,974 yards | Public | Parkland

Worst course I have ever played.
Well, I have to say what a disappointing experience I had at the golf course this weekend. It is safe to say the course should have been closed.I appreciate there has been a lot of rain recently and the fairways are far from being able to be cut, but I've never played a course in worse conditions.
The fairways would grace most courses as areas around the unkempt tee boxes. The tee boxes, when you could see the markers were as long as some of the fairway grass and had not been kept or tidied for some time. The moss on the greens were happy with the wet conditions. No matter where you walked it was a quagmire. Even the greens sank beneath your feet to allow water to rise.
So why did I continue to play? This weekend I was sleeping out rough for charity and had an opportunity to visit a course in the vicinity rather lay underneath a cardboard box I thought I would visit a course.
What is worse than the course in the condition it was is that hidden within the website is an acknowledgement that the courses irrigation system has failed and the owners are aware, that the course needs investment and designer is earmarked to come in and transform it.... knowingly charging the same rates.
I think this nugget of information should be advertised more prominently. I wish I had taken the green fees and just donated it to the charity I was supporting as it would have made a better difference elsewhere!

Mudbath - AVOID
Regrettably played this course on Saturday 27th January 2018 – we walked in after 11 holes due to it being a mud bath. There was no difference between the length of the grass on the fairways and the rough and there was what appeared to be a rabbit scrape in the middle of one of the greens. There was slippery mud everywhere, pools of water which were impossible to avoid. THIS COURSE SHOULD NOT HAVE BEEN OPEN (if only to protect the course).We spoke to someone working in the professional shop once we had changed out of our dirty clothing and his response was “you are entitled to your opinion” – not exactly decent customer service.
We spoke to a local in the car park afterwards and he said that the course is well known in the area for being in this condition and “unplayable” for at least 3 months of the year.
PLAY IT AT YOUR PERIL.
